Buyer's Guide

What to Look for in a Smart Power Strip

Weather Resistance

Check IP ratings. IP54 handles rain; indoor-only strips fail quickly outdoors. Covered porches tolerate indoor models, but exposed areas demand true weatherproofing.

Outlet Count and Control

Four to six outlets suffice for most porches. Individual control lets you schedule lights, cameras, and accessories separately without affecting always-on devices.

Voice Assistant Compatibility

Alexa and Google support is standard. Amazon Basics works only with Alexa—verify compatibility with your ecosystem before buying.

Surge Protection Rating

Look for 1000+ joules. Porches face more electrical spikes from storms. Higher ratings protect expensive gear like heaters and entertainment systems.

Cord Length and Plug Type

Six-foot cords reach distant outlets. Flat plugs sit flush against walls, reducing tripping hazards and letting furniture sit closer.

App Features and Scheduling

Robust apps offer timers, scenes, and remote access. Test app reviews before buying—clunky software ruins the smart home experience.

Frequently Asked Questions

Smart Home — FAQ

Can I use an indoor smart power strip on my porch?
Only if fully covered. Even then, humidity and temperature swings cause premature failure. For exposed areas, use IP-rated outdoor models like our top pick.
What's the difference between a smart power strip and individual smart plugs?
Strips combine multiple outlets in one device, saving space and cost. Individual plugs offer flexibility but create clutter and require multiple wall sockets.
Do these work with 5GHz WiFi?
Most use 2.4GHz only. It penetrates walls better and reaches porches reliably. Verify router settings—some strips won't connect to 5GHz networks.
How many devices can I control simultaneously?
Typically one device per outlet. Most apps control unlimited strips, but check your router's device limit—some handle only 32 connections.
Are outdoor smart strips safe in heavy rain?
IP54-rated strips handle light rain and splashes. Direct downpours or submersion will damage them. Mount under eaves for best protection.
Can I schedule individual outlets on the same strip?
Yes. Quality strips offer per-outlet control. Set lights on a timer, keep cameras always-on, and schedule heaters for evenings—all from one strip.
